Understanding ADHD
ADHD is typically detected in childhood, though it can persist into adolescence and their adult years. Symptoms can manifest variably, causing different presentations such as predominantly inattentive type, primarily hyperactive-impulsive type, and combined type. According to the CDC, around 6.1 million kids in the United States have actually been detected with ADHD, making awareness and proper evaluation crucial.
Symptoms of ADHD
Typical symptoms of ADHD can be categorized as follows:
-
Inattention:
- Difficulty sustaining attention in jobs or play activities
- Frequent reckless mistakes in schoolwork or other activities
- Trouble arranging jobs and activities
-
Hyperactivity:
- Fidgeting or tapping hands or feet
- Problem remaining seated in situations where anticipated
- Extreme talking
-
Impulsivity:
- Blurting out answers before concerns have been completed
- Problem awaiting one's turn
- Interrupting or intruding on others' discussions or video games
Understanding these symptoms can help people recognize whether they may require to participate in more assessment.
The Role of Online Tests for ADHD
Online ADHD tests act as an interactive tool that individuals can use to assess whether they exhibit symptoms consistent with ADHD. These tests generally consist of a series of questions that determine behaviors and obstacles associated with attention and hyperactivity.
Advantages of Online ADHD Tests
- Ease of access:
Online tests can be taken from the convenience of home, making them available to a wider audience. - Relieve of Use:
Most online tests do not require special knowledge or training, allowing people to self-assess convenience. - Immediate Feedback:
Results are frequently supplied immediately, enabling people to gain insight rapidly. - Cost-efficient:
Many online tests are free or low-priced compared to expert assessments.
Limitations of Online ADHD Tests
In spite of their benefits, online tests for ADHD may have specific downsides:
- Lack of Professional Oversight:
Without the assistance of a qualified healthcare specialist, results might be misleading. - Variability in Test Quality:
Not all online tests are developed with scientific rigor, with some lacking validation. - Prospective for Misdiagnosis:
Tests may suggest ADHD, however only a professional assessment can verify a medical diagnosis. - False Sense of Security:
Individuals might feel overly confident in an assessment without looking for additional assessment, causing neglected symptoms.

Finest Practices for Online ADHD Testing
For those considering taking an online test for ADHD, the following best practices can assist ensure a more reputable experience:
- Seek Reputable Sites: Choose tests that are backed by medical organizations or reputable mental institutions.
- Use as a Screening Tool: Treat online tests as a preliminary step, not a conclusive diagnosis. It's necessary to follow up with a health care supplier.
- Be Honest in Responses: To ensure precise outcomes, people need to respond honestly based on their common habits.
- Inquire About Multiple Sources: If the test recommends ADHD might be a concern, gather details from numerous sources (household, teachers, or coworkers), and talk about these findings with a healthcare specialist.
FAQs About Online Tests for ADHD
1. Can online tests provide a conclusive medical diagnosis for ADHD?
No, online tests can not supply a definitive diagnosis. They can show whether more examination might be required, but an extensive assessment must be performed by a qualified health care expert.
2. How precise are online ADHD tests?

3. Exist age limitations for taking online ADHD tests?
Numerous online tests can be taken by people of all ages, but certain tests might be designed specifically for kids or adults. It is vital to ensure that the test is suitable for the individual's age group.
4. What should I do if the test suggests I might have ADHD?
If the test suggests that you might have ADHD, the next action would be to consult a health care expert who focuses on ADHD for an extensive evaluation and prospective medical diagnosis.
5. For how long do online ADHD tests normally take to finish?
A lot of online ADHD tests take 10 to 30 minutes to finish, depending upon the variety of questions and the complexity of the assessment.
